A note on spacelike weighted translating solitons in weighted Lorentzian product spaces

We apply some maximum principles to establish rigidity results concerning complete spacelike weighted translating solitons immersed in a weighted Lorentzian product space \({\mathbb {R}}_1\times {\mathbb {P}}^n_f\) R 1 × P f n endowed with a potential function f and whose Riemannian base \({\mathbb {P}}^n\) P n is supposed to be complete and with nonnegative Bakry–Émery–Ricci tensor. As applications, we derive new Calabi–Bernstein type results for entire spacelike weighted translating graphs constructed over \({\mathbb {P}}^n.\) P n .
